电脑创意编程是什么意思

worktile 其他 23

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    电脑创意编程是指利用计算机技术和编程语言,创造出具有创意和艺术性的程序和应用。它不仅仅局限于传统的软件开发,更注重将艺术、设计和技术相结合,通过编写代码和算法,创造出独特而有趣的数字艺术作品、交互式应用、游戏和动画等。这种编程方式注重创造力和想象力的发挥,通过不断尝试和实验,将编程与艺术相结合,创造出独特的数字体验。

    在电脑创意编程中,艺术家和设计师可以利用编程语言和工具来探索新的创意表达方式。他们可以使用图形编程语言如Processing、OpenFrameworks和Cinder,来创建各种艺术作品和交互式应用。通过编写代码,他们可以控制图形、动画、音频和视频等元素,创造出丰富多样的视觉和听觉效果,使观众能够与作品进行互动和参与。

    电脑创意编程也可以应用于游戏开发领域。游戏开发者可以利用编程技术和工具,创造出独特的游戏体验。他们可以编写游戏逻辑、设计游戏关卡和角色,运用物理引擎和人工智能技术,实现真实的游戏交互和沉浸式体验。通过创意编程,游戏开发者可以打破传统游戏设计的限制,创造出更具创新性和想象力的游戏作品。

    除了艺术和游戏领域,电脑创意编程还可以应用于数据可视化、互动装置和虚拟现实等领域。通过编写代码,开发者可以将数据转化为可视化图形,帮助人们更好地理解和分析数据。他们还可以利用编程技术和传感器,设计和制作各种互动装置,创造出与观众互动的艺术装置和展览。此外,电脑创意编程还可以应用于虚拟现实和增强现实技术,创造出身临其境的虚拟体验。

    总之,电脑创意编程是一种将艺术、设计和技术相结合的创造性编程方式。它通过编写代码和算法,创造出具有创意和艺术性的数字作品和应用。电脑创意编程不仅仅是一种技术,更是一种表达和探索创意的方式,为艺术家、设计师和开发者提供了无限的可能性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    电脑创意编程是指通过使用计算机编程语言和工具,创造出具有创意和艺术性的程序和应用程序的过程。它结合了计算机科学和创意艺术,旨在通过编程来表达个人的创造力和想象力。

    以下是电脑创意编程的一些重要概念和意义:

    1. 创意表达:电脑创意编程提供了一种创意表达的方式,让人们能够将自己的创造力和想法通过编程来实现。程序员可以通过编写代码来创造出独特的艺术作品、交互式应用程序和虚拟现实体验。

    2. 艺术性和美学:电脑创意编程强调程序和应用程序的艺术性和美学价值。程序员可以使用图形、音频、视频和动画等多种媒体形式来创造出富有美感和创意的作品。这种创意编程的作品常常被称为“艺术程序”或“艺术编码”。

    3. 交互体验:电脑创意编程可以创建出具有交互性的应用程序和艺术作品。通过编写代码,程序员可以使用户能够与作品进行互动,参与其中,创造出独特的体验。这种交互性可以通过触摸屏、手势识别、声音感应等技术来实现。

    4. 教育和学习:电脑创意编程也被广泛应用于教育领域。通过编写代码,学生可以培养创造力、逻辑思维和解决问题的能力。创意编程还可以激发学生对科学、技术、工程和数学的兴趣,培养他们在STEM领域的能力。

    5. 开放性和共享性:电脑创意编程强调开放性和共享性。许多创意编程的工具和库都是开源的,任何人都可以使用和修改。这种共享的精神促进了创意编程社区的发展和合作,使更多人能够参与到创意编程的活动中来。

    总的来说,电脑创意编程是一种将计算机科学和创意艺术相结合的活动,通过编写代码来创造出具有创意和艺术性的程序和应用程序。它不仅提供了一种创意表达的方式,还能够培养学生的创造力和解决问题的能力,推动科学、技术、工程和数学的发展。同时,创意编程也强调开放性和共享性,促进了创意编程社区的合作和发展。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    电脑创意编程是一种将创意与编程技术相结合的编程方法。它通过使用计算机编程语言和工具来实现创意思维,创造出独特、有趣和创新的计算机程序、应用和艺术作品。

    电脑创意编程的目的是探索计算机编程的创造性潜力,将编程技术应用于艺术、设计、音乐、游戏等领域,以创造出独特的作品。它不仅要求编程技术的熟练运用,还需要创意思维和艺术设计的能力。

    下面将从方法、操作流程等方面详细介绍电脑创意编程的意义。

    一、方法

    1.1 创意思维:电脑创意编程需要具备创意思维能力,能够从不同的角度思考问题,提出独特的创意和创新的解决方案。

    1.2 编程技术:掌握各种编程语言和工具,如Python、Processing、Unity等,能够运用编程技术实现创意想法。

    1.3 艺术设计:电脑创意编程涉及到艺术设计,需要具备艺术感知能力和设计能力,能够将编程与艺术结合,创造出美观、有趣的作品。

    二、操作流程

    2.1 确定创意:首先需要确定创意,思考想要创造的作品类型和主题,例如游戏、艺术装置、音乐生成等。

    2.2 学习编程技术:根据创意,选择相应的编程语言和工具,学习相关的编程技术和知识。

    2.3 实现创意:根据学习的编程技术,使用编程语言和工具编写代码,实现创意想法。

    2.4 调试和优化:编写完成后,需要进行调试和优化,确保程序的正常运行和良好的用户体验。

    2.5 展示作品:完成调试和优化后,可以将作品展示给他人,获得反馈和评价。也可以通过互联网平台分享作品,与他人交流和合作。

    三、意义

    3.1 创造性表达:电脑创意编程为人们提供了一种创造性表达的方式,通过编程技术实现自己的创意和想法,将抽象的思维转化为具体的作品。

    3.2 艺术创作:电脑创意编程将艺术和编程结合,创造出独特的艺术作品,丰富了艺术创作的形式和内容。

    3.3 教育意义:电脑创意编程不仅可以培养创造力和创新精神,还可以提高学生的计算思维能力和问题解决能力,促进综合素质的发展。

    3.4 技术应用:电脑创意编程的技术应用广泛,可以应用于游戏开发、虚拟现实、人工智能等领域,推动技术的创新和发展。

    总之,电脑创意编程是一种将创意与编程技术相结合的编程方法,通过创意思维、编程技术和艺术设计,创造出独特、有趣和创新的计算机程序、应用和艺术作品。它在创造性表达、艺术创作、教育意义和技术应用等方面具有重要意义。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部